INSTRUCTIONS
FORMING PART OF THE TERMS AND CONDITIONS OF THE EXCHANGE OFFER
1. DELIVERY OF LETTER OF TRANSMITTAL AND CERTIFICATES; GUARANTEED DELIVERY
PROCEDURES. This Letter of Transmittal is to be completed either if (a)
Certificates are to be forwarded herewith or (b) tenders are to be made pursuant
to the procedures for tender by book-entry transfer set forth in "The Exchange
Offer -- Procedures for Tendering Original Notes" in the Prospectus and an
Agent's Message is not delivered. Certificates, or timely confirmation of a
book-entry transfer of such Original Notes into the Exchange Agent's account at
DTC, as well as this Letter of Transmittal (or facsimile thereof), properly
completed and duly executed, with any required signature guarantees, and any
other documents required by this Letter of Transmittal, must be received by the
Exchange Agent at any of its addresses set forth herein on or prior to the
Expiration Date. Tenders by book-entry transfer may also be made by delivering
an Agent's Message in lieu of this Letter of Transmittal. The term "Agent's
Message" means a message, transmitted by DTC to and received by the Exchange
Agent and forming a part of a book-entry confirmation, which states that DTC has
received an express acknowledgment from the DTC participant, which
acknowledgment states that such participant has received and agrees to be bound
by the Letter of Transmittal (including the representations contained herein)
and that Energy Holdings may enforce the Letter of Transmittal against such
participant. Original Notes may be tendered in whole or in part in integral
multiples of $1,000.
Holders who wish to tender their Original Notes and (i) whose Original
Notes are not immediately available or (ii) who cannot deliver their Original
Notes, this Letter of Transmittal and all other required documents to the
Exchange Agent on or prior to the Expiration Date or (iii) who cannot complete
the procedures for delivery by book-entry transfer on a timely basis, may tender
their Original Notes by properly completing and duly executing a Notice of
Guaranteed Delivery pursuant to the guaranteed delivery procedures set forth in
"The Exchange Offer -- Procedures for Tendering Original Notes" in the
Prospectus. Pursuant to such procedures: (A) such tender must be made by or
through an Eligible Institution (as defined below); (B) a properly completed and
duly executed Notice of Guaranteed Delivery, substantially in the form made
available by Energy Holdings, must be received by the Exchange Agent on or prior
to the expiration date; and (C) the Certificates (or a book-entry confirmation
(as defined in the Prospectus)) representing all tendered Original Notes, in
proper form for transfer, together with a Letter of Transmittal (or facsimile
thereof), properly completed and duly executed, with any required signature
guarantees and any other documents required by this Letter of Transmittal, must
be received by the Exchange Agent within three New York Stock Exchange trading
days after the date of execution of such Notice of Guaranteed Delivery, all as
provided in "The Exchange Offer -- Procedures for Tendering Original Notes" in
the Prospectus.
The Notice of Guaranteed Delivery may be delivered by hand or transmitted
by facsimile or mail to the Exchange Agent, and must include a guarantee by an
Eligible Institution in the form set forth in such Notice. For Original Notes to
be properly tendered pursuant to the guaranteed delivery procedure, the Exchange
Agent must receive a Notice of Guaranteed Delivery on or prior to the Expiration
Date. As used herein and in the Prospectus, "Eligible Institution" means a firm
or other entity identified in Rule 17Ad-15 under the Exchange Act as an
"Eligible Guarantor Institution," including (as such terms are defined therein)
(i) a bank; (ii) a broker, dealer, municipal securities broker or dealer or
government securities broker or dealer; (iii) a credit union; (iv) a national
securities exchange, registered securities association or clearing agency; or
(v) a savings association that is a participant in a Securities Transfer
Association.

9. 31% BACKUP WITHHOLDING; SUBSTITUTE FORM W-9. Under U.S. Federal income
tax law, a holder whose tendered Original Notes are accepted for exchange is
required to provide the Exchange Agent with such holder's correct taxpayer
identification number ("TIN") on Substitute Form W-9 below. If the Exchange
Agent is not provided with the correct TIN, the Internal Revenue Service (the
"IRS") may subject the holder or other payee to a $50 penalty. In addition,
payments to such holders or other payees with respect to Original Notes
exchanged pursuant to the Exchange Offer may be subject to 31% backup
withholding.
10
<PAGE>
The box in Part 2 of the Substitute Form W-9 may be checked if the
tendering holder has not been issued a TIN and has applied for a TIN or intends
to apply for a TIN in the near future. If the box in Part 2 is checked, the
holder or other payee must also complete the Certificate of Awaiting Taxpayer
Identification Number below in order to avoid backup withholding.
Notwithstanding that the box in Part 2 is checked and the Certificate of
Awaiting Taxpayer Identification Number is completed, the Exchange Agent will
withhold 31% of all payments made prior to the time a properly certified TIN is
provided to the Exchange Agent. The Exchange Agent will retain such amounts
withheld during the 60 day period following the date of the Substitute Form W-9.
If the holder furnishes the Exchange Agent with its TIN within 60 days after the
date of the Substitute Form W-9, the amounts retained during the 60 day period
will be remitted to the holder and no further amounts shall be retained or
withheld from payments made to the holder thereafter. If, however, the holder
has not provided the Exchange Agent with its TIN within such 60 day period,
amounts withheld will be remitted to the IRS as backup withholding. In addition,
31% of all payments made thereafter will be withheld and remitted to the IRS
until a correct TIN is provided.
The holder is required to give the Exchange Agent the TIN (e.g., social
security number or employer identification number) of the registered owner of
the Original Notes or of the last transferee appearing on the transfers attached
to, or endorsed on, the Original Notes. If the Original Notes are registered in
more than one name or are not in the name of the actual owner, consult the
enclosed "Guidelines for Certification of Taxpayer Identification Number on
Substitute Form W-9" for additional guidance on which number to report.
Certain holders (including, among others, corporations, financial
institutions and certain foreign persons) may not be subject to these backup
withholding and reporting requirements. Such holders should nevertheless
complete the attached Substitute Form W-9 below, and write "exempt" on the face
thereof, to avoid possible erroneous backup withholding. A foreign person may
qualify as an exempt recipient by submitting a properly completed IRS Form W-8,
signed under penalties of perjury, attesting to that holder's exempt status.
Please consult the enclosed "Guidelines for Certification of Taxpayer
Identification Number on Substitute Form W-9" for additional guidance on which
holders are exempt from backup withholding.
Backup withholding is not an additional U.S. Federal income tax. Rather,
the U.S. Federal income tax liability of a person subject to backup withholding
will be reduced by the amount of tax withheld. If withholding results in an
overpayment of taxes, a refund may be obtained.
